Students Celebrate Competition Success

Read time: approx 1 mins

UCB hairdressing and Theatrical Special Effects Hair and Media Make-up students travelled to the Winter Gardens in Blackpool to compete in the UK trainee finals of the Association of Hairdressers and Therapists (AHT).

To get to the prestigious Blackpool finals students first had to get through the local heat held in Bedworth, Warwickshire and UCB Staff Janet Dancer, Pia Dimmer and Michelle Beddall mentored the students in the run up to the events.

Five students secured a place in the Blackpool finals, where trainees from 49 colleges from all over the UK went to compete and to demonstrate and share their skills. The students who made the journey were Natasha Gaynor, Alliesse Farrelly, Sabina Yunosova, Lian Baxter and Zaneta Swiatlowska.

UCB students entered the Gents and ladies progressive categories along with avant-garde facial make-up and ladies alternative African Caribbean and walked away with a first place for Sabina and Alliesse and a second place for Taneca.

Well done to all of the students who travelled to Blackpool and the staff who gave up their time to mentor them – everyone is looking forward to next year’s competition already!
